Movies in the Northtowne Mall in Defiance, Ohio haven't been shown since the Northtowne Cinemas was closed by MovieScoop Cinemas in June 2022. Moviegoers in the area will be glad to hear that the movie theater will be reopening in early 2023!
According to a release issued by Phoenix Theatres (see below), the nine-screen movie theater will be getting $1.43 million in upgrades before it opens. Heated recliners will be installed so customers can enjoy the digital projection and Dolby Atmos immersive audio systems, but only after they walked through the new lobby and concession stand areas.
The announcement included the following list of amenities that you can expect:
- A new spacious lobby and concessions area
- Combined ticketing and concession purchases in one line
- Self-serve Pepsi drink stations for added service speed and convenience
- Specially equipped premium format auditoriums featuring Dolby Atmos® immersive sound systems and Christie® Digital projection
- Reserved seating
- Every seat in every auditorium will be a large love-seat style (with adjustable middle armrest), fully reclining, heated chair with 75 inches of leg room
"We are excited to welcome Phoenix Theatres to Northtowne Mall as we believe they will be a tremendous asset not only to the mall, but also to the greater Defiance community," said Teresa Page, Northtowne's Mall Manager.
"We have been extremely impressed with how fully engaged and professional the entire Phoenix team has been throughout this process to bring such an upgraded theatre experience to the mall," Page said. "I think our patrons are really going to be pleased with the addition. We certainly are."
When it opens, it will be known as the Phoenix Theatres - Northtowne Mall. It will be the first location in Ohio for Michigan-based Phoenix Theatres, which currently operates theaters in Iowa, Massachusetts, and Michigan.
Until it reopens, moviegoers in the area will need to visit one of the other nearby theaters, including the Bryan Theatre in Bryan and the Skye Cinema in Wauseon.

PHOENIX THEATRES TO RELAUNCH THEATRE AT NORTHTOWNE MALL
Michigan-Based Co. Invests $1.43 Million to Return First-Run Films with First-Class Amenities, To Open Western Ohio's First Theatre with Dolby ATMOS
September 18, 2022
Defiance, Ohio September 19, 2022 – Movies are returning to Northtowne Mall as Phoenix Theatres has signed a long-term lease to bring first-run movies and first-class amenities back to the mall, including becoming the first theatre in Western Ohio to have Dolby ATMOS®.
Phoenix Theatres, the 22-year-old independently owned movie theatre company plans to invest $1.43 million to refurbish the 9-screen theatre, creating a new premiere movie-going experience in the greater Defiance area. Renovation plans have been developed for the 27,857-square-foot building, which will feature all-new premium reclining heated seating, digital projection, Dolby ATMOS audio, a new spacious lobby & concession stand, first-run movies and family-friendly pricing. The plan matches very similar activities and upgrades by Phoenix Theatre's ongoing amenities in its six additional theatre facilities in three states.
The Northtowne Mall project marks the 59th screen for Michigan-based Phoenix Theatres, which operates theatres in Michigan, Iowa, and Massachusetts. This is the first location in Ohio for Phoenix Theatres, which expects to welcome its first Northtowne Mall moviegoers in early 2023.

Phoenix Theatres President Cory Jacobson said he knew they would be a good fit for the Defiance property right from the start. "We have been keeping a very close eye on the Defiance community for over 7 years and waiting for this opportunity to become available," Jacobson said.
"Phoenix Theatres has always been a neighborhood theatre company, and that's something we're very proud of," Jacobson added. "After spending several weeks exploring the city, we felt very much at home in the culture of the community. Movie theatres are places where people come together to enjoy themselves. Creating an environment that celebrates community has always been our highest goal."

"We were one of the first in the United States to offer 100% reclining seating in every auditorium," said John Scanlan, COO of Phoenix Theatres. "Our goal is to offer the highest-quality first-run movie-going experience by offering state-of-the-art digital projection and Dolby ATMOS audio along with comfortable luxury amenities. We focus on the little details that large national theatre chains just cannot provide at the local level. "
"We were fortunate to be considered for this opportunity at Northtowne Mall and look forward to bringing our own unique amenities to the greater Defiance community. Phoenix was originally formed with the idea of refurbishing closed theatres in viable retail areas and returning well-operated neighborhood theatres to their respective communities."
BACKGROUND
The Michigan based Phoenix Theatres opened its first Detroit-area theatre in 2001 and currently operates 7 theatres, with the introduction of Northtowne marking their 59th theatre screen.
